Mold Stripper

"Not the best place to work unless you need the money."

What do you like about working at Corning?

"The pay rate at the time was good for a college student's summer job."

What don't you like about working at Corning?

"Rotating shifts, every week is a different shift. Also working around a 2000+ degree oven is not the most satisfactory working conditions"

What suggestions do you have for management?

"None really, as the job has to be done and the only way to make the process more appealing would cause many people to lose their jobs."

Corning Reviews FAQs

Is Corning a good company to work for?

Corning has an overall rating of 4.0 Average Rating out of 5, based on over 64 Corning Review Ratings left anonymously by Corning employees, which is 3% higher than the average rating for all companies on CareerBliss. 95% of employees would recommend working at Corning.

Does Corning pay their employees well?

Corning employees earn $65,000 annually on average, or $31 per hour, which is 2% lower than the national salary average of $66,000 per year. 36 Corning employees have shared their salaries on CareerBliss. Find Corning Salaries by Job Title.

How satisfied are employees working at Corning?

95% of employees would recommend working at Corning with the overall rating of 4.0 out of 5. Employees also rated Corning 4.1 out of 5 for Company Culture, 4.0 for Rewards You Receive, 3.7 for Growth Opportunities and 4.1 for support you get.
